目次
回复讨论(解决方案)
ホームページ バックエンド開発 PHPチュートリアル 特定のキャラクターが遭遇したときにそれを迎撃する方法は?

特定のキャラクターが遭遇したときにそれを迎撃する方法は?

Jun 23, 2016 pm 01:54 PM
インターセプト

比如经常发表一些新闻

格式都是很规则的使用  XXXXXXX, XXX。XXXXXX,XXXXX。

如何做到,  截取第一次出现的。及之前的文字
或第二次出现。及之前前文字

比如以下红字

这里发言,表示您接受了CSDN论坛的用户行为准则。请对您的言行负责,并遵守中华人民共和国有关法律法规,尊重网上道德。转载文章请注明出自“CSDN(www.csdn.net)”。如是商业用途请联系原作者。


如何用php来智能截取?  第一或第二句  一个"。"算一句


回复讨论(解决方案)

$s = '这里发言,表示您接受了CSDN论坛的用户行为准则。请对您的言行负责,并遵守中华人民共和国有关法律法规,尊重网上道德。转载文章请注明出自“CSDN(www.csdn.net)”。如是商业用途请联系原作者。';echo preg_replace('/((?:.+?。){1}).+/', '$1', $s);
ログイン後にコピー
这里发言,表示您接受了CSDN论坛的用户行为准则。
echo preg_replace('/((?:.+?。){2}).+/', '$1', $s);
ログイン後にコピー
这里发言,表示您接受了CSDN论坛的用户行为准则。请对您的言行负责,并遵守中华人民共和国有关法律法规,尊重网上道德。

用explode 以。号分割也是可以的

谢谢两位版主

この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

Video Face Swap

Video Face Swap

完全無料の AI 顔交換ツールを使用して、あらゆるビデオの顔を簡単に交換できます。

ホットツール

メモ帳++7.3.1

メモ帳++7.3.1

使いやすく無料のコードエディター

SublimeText3 中国語版

SublimeText3 中国語版

中国語版、とても使いやすい

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統合開発環境

ドリームウィーバー CS6

ドリームウィーバー CS6

ビジュアル Web 開発ツール

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

Go言語の文字列インターセプト方法の詳細説明 Go言語の文字列インターセプト方法の詳細説明 Mar 13, 2024 am 08:03 AM

Go 言語の文字列インターセプトメソッドの詳細な説明 Go 言語では、文字列は不変のバイト列であるため、文字列インターセプトを実装するにはいくつかのメソッドを使用する必要があります。文字列インターセプトは、文字列の特定の部分を取得するための一般的な操作です。必要に応じて、文字列の最初の数文字、最後の数文字、または特定の位置から特定の長さの文字をインターセプトできます。この記事では、Go言語で文字列をインターセプトする方法と具体的なコード例を詳しく紹介します。スライスを使用して文字列インターセプトを実装する Go 言語では、スライスを使用して次のことを行うことができます。

MySQL で ROUND 関数を使用して小数点以下の桁をインターセプトする方法 MySQL で ROUND 関数を使用して小数点以下の桁をインターセプトする方法 Jul 13, 2023 pm 09:21 PM

MySQL で ROUND 関数を使用して小数点以下の桁数をインターセプトする方法 MySQL では、ROUND 関数を使用して小数点以下の桁数をインターセプトできます。 ROUND 関数は、数値を指定された小数点以下の桁数に丸めます。以下では、ROUND 関数の使用方法を詳しく紹介し、コード例を示します。構文: ROUND(X,D)X は四捨五入される数値を表し、D は保持される小数点以下の桁数を表します。 ROUND 関数を使用して小数点以下の桁数を取得する例: produc という名前のテーブルがあるとします。

PHP 中国語文字列インターセプト スキル: mb_substr() に別れを告げる PHP 中国語文字列インターセプト スキル: mb_substr() に別れを告げる Mar 15, 2024 pm 12:18 PM

PHP 開発では、中国語の文字列をインターセプトする必要がある状況によく遭遇します。従来、中国語の文字のインターセプトを処理するには、通常 mb_substr() 関数を使用しますが、そのパフォーマンスは低く、十分な可読性はありません。この記事では、いくつかの新しい中国語文字列インターセプト手法を紹介し、mb_substr() に別れを告げ、コードの効率と可読性を向上させます。正規表現を使用して中国語の文字列をインターセプトする 正規表現を使用して中国語の文字列をインターセプトするのは、効率的で簡潔な方法です。正規表現を使用して中国語を照合できます

UniApp が画像のアップロードとトリミングを実装する方法 UniApp が画像のアップロードとトリミングを実装する方法 Jul 06, 2023 am 10:01 AM

UniApp は、Vue.js に基づくクロスプラットフォーム アプリケーション開発フレームワークで、iOS と Android の両方のプラットフォーム向けのアプリケーションを迅速に開発できます。 UniApp では、画像のアップロードとトリミングは一般的な要件です。この記事では、UniApp で画像のアップロードとトリミングを実装する方法を紹介し、対応するコード例を示します。 1. 画像アップロードの実装方法: uni.uploadFile() メソッドを使用して画像をアップロードします。まず、uni.uploa を設定する必要があります。

Go言語の文字列インターセプト関数を素早くマスターする Go言語の文字列インターセプト関数を素早くマスターする Mar 12, 2024 pm 06:15 PM

Go言語の文字列インターセプト機能をサクッとマスター Go言語は、シンプルさと効率性という特徴を持ち、多くの開発者に支持されている近年注目を集めているプログラミング言語です。 Go 言語では、文字列処理は非常に一般的な操作であり、文字列インターセプト関数はその重要な部分です。この記事では、Go 言語の文字列インターセプト関数をすぐにマスターできるように、具体的なコード例を使用します。 1. 基本的な文字列インターセプト. Go 言語の文字列はインデックスを通じてインターセプトできます. コード例は次のとおりです:

Java 開発における文字列インターセプトとスプライシングのパフォーマンスを最適化する方法 Java 開発における文字列インターセプトとスプライシングのパフォーマンスを最適化する方法 Jun 29, 2023 pm 06:04 PM

Java 開発における文字列のインターセプトとスプライシングのパフォーマンスを最適化する方法: 日常の Java 開発では、文字列のインターセプトとスプライシングは非常に一般的な操作です。ただし、Java の文字列は不変であるため、文字列のインターセプトおよびスプライシング操作が頻繁に行われると、パフォーマンスが低下する可能性があります。 Java 開発における文字列のインターセプトとスプライシングのパフォーマンスを向上させるために、次の最適化戦略を採用できます。 StringBuilder または StringBuffer を使用した連結: Java の場合、String

Go言語における文字列インターセプトの実装原理を深く理解する Go言語における文字列インターセプトの実装原理を深く理解する Mar 12, 2024 pm 06:27 PM

Go 言語は高性能プログラミング言語として、文字列の操作と処理のためのメソッドと関数を豊富に提供します。中でも文字列インターセプト操作はよく使う機能の一つです。この記事では、Go 言語での文字列インターセプトの実装原理を詳しく掘り下げ、具体的なコード例を通じて実装プロセスを示します。文字列インターセプトとは何ですか? Go 言語では、文字列インターセプトとは、文字列から部分的な部分文字列をインターセプトする操作を指します。開始位置と終了位置を指定することで、元の文字列の指定範囲を取得できます

Java 12 の新機能: 新しい String API を使用して文字列をインターセプトおよび連結する方法 Java 12 の新機能: 新しい String API を使用して文字列をインターセプトおよび連結する方法 Jul 31, 2023 pm 12:55 PM

Java は広く使用されているプログラミング言語として継続的に開発および更新されており、新しいバージョンごとに、開発者のコ​​ーディング効率を向上させるためのいくつかの新機能が導入されています。最新バージョンの Java12 の機能の 1 つは、文字列のインターセプトと連結をより便利かつ効率的に行う新しい StringAPI の導入です。以前のバージョンでは、文字列のインターセプトと連結の操作は、substring() と "+" 演算子を呼び出して実装する必要がありましたが、これらのメソッドは多数の文字列操作を処理できませんでした。

See all articles